About Stigmatomma
Stigmatomma is a genus within the family Formicidae , classified in the subfamily Amblyoponinae (tribe Amblyoponini) . AntScout currently documents 58 species in this genus, distributed across 18 countries , including Canada, China, Croatia, Côte d'Ivoire, Ghana.
Species in this genus exhibit monogynous and polygynous and oligogynous and optionally polygynous colony structures. Monogynous colonies have a single reproductive queen, making them straightforward to start from a single founding queen - ideal for beginner ant keepers. Polygynous colonies can host multiple queens, allowing for rapid colony growth.
Nuptial flights of Stigmatomma species have been recorded during: Jun, Aug, Sep. These flights are when new queens and males leave the nest to mate - the best time to find a founding queen in the wild.
